Yeah, It's a Gray Nicolls Nitro Bag - new for 2011.

I think it's pretty much the same as their old Xiphos bag. It can stand up as well as lie flat. Two main external pockets (which i used to clothing and boots + extras. You get into the main part of the bag from the top and it's mainly all one big compartment where it easily fits in my pads, protection, gloves helmet etc with plenty of space. Also inside the bag there are two hidden bat compartments however they aren't protected well.

It's decently priced to be fair and if I had the extra money I would've gone for the Ayrtek bag. How are you getting on with it so far?
